Chlorophyll is green pigment stored on chloroplast thylakoids where it participates in the process of photosynthesis as a light collector and photoelectric transformer.
There are five types of chlorophylls, but chlorophyll a is the main pigment of photosynthesis and is contained in all green plants that perform photosynthesis.
Chlorophyll has the ability of fluorescence, which means that the light it absorbs can be released again. Therefore, the solution of chlorophyll, observed in the tube in reflected light, is a deep red color.
